______________________________________________________________________________________ The Adult Working Canine Training Camp is a five-day systematic education and training seminar that teaches participants to correctly administer, score, interpret, and communicate the Brownell-Marsolais Instrument (BMI). At the conclusion of the seminar, attendees will be able to translate their findings into the proper selection of K9s for Search-and-Rescue (SAR), detection, competition, and therapeutic working assignments. ______________________________________________________________________________________Dates: July 19 - July 24This is an Overnight Camp. ______________________________________________________________________________________Cost: $1,600 per participant for overnight and $1,000 per participant if only joining during the day.
